Tips for using O.R. Tambo International

O.R. Tambo International is one of the busiest airports on the African continent. It is imperative to budget enough time for queues in Immigration and Security. The suggested time to arrive at the airport for International Departures is 3 hours and 2 hours for Domestic Departures.

The airport is large but signage is used widely (and in English) if you get lost.

There is a large selection of food, coffee shops, pharmacies and Wi-Fi in the Departures area.

Avoid people who will offer to carry your bags to your airport transfer as they will request payment.

For non-IPTA-related travels

Cash and card are widely accepted throughout main cities in South Africa.

Although South Africa has 12 official languages, English is spoken widely.

For local travel in Johannesburg

Johannesburg is large and mostly unwalkable. The three best options for local transport within Johannesburg are: private car rental, Uber, and the Gautrain.

Uber is strongly recommended over metered taxis. It is recommended to Uber from the drop-off zone (clearly marked outside Arrivals) at the airport. Avoid local unlicensed taxis who offer rides in and outside the airport.

The Gautrain is an excellent option for local travel in the Johannesburg/Pretoria region. There is a Gautrain station inside the airport, which can take you to major places in Johannesburg, Sandton and Pretoria; from where you can Uber to your final location. Avoid Ubering from the Gautrain Pretoria Station and Park Station.

If you intend to travel to other parts of the country

Other popular tourist destinations within South Africa include Cape Town, Durban, and Kruger National Park. You can take a domestic flight to any of these locations from O.R. Tambo International. When travelling in these other cities, Uber and private vehicle hire are the best modes of transportation.
